The evolution of large language models (LLMs) has opened the door to conversational systems and autonomous agents capable of maintaining complex interactions across multiple turns, invoking external tools, and managing workflows between sessions. However, this progress brings a critical challenge: the accumulation of extensive contexts that, when fully reproduced in each request, increase preprocessing costs, exceed memory limits, and dilute truly relevant information among superfluous data, negatively impacting both service efficiency and response quality. To address this issue, Akashic emerges as a low-overhead memory system that, through MemAttention, organizes context into bounded chunks and models the semantic relationships between them, preserving distributed evidence without needing to rewrite the entire history. This approach, accompanied by a co-designed hardware-software memory placement strategy, reduces fragmentation in data retrieval and minimizes input/output overhead, achieving improvements of up to 10.2 points in accuracy, 21% in throughput, and 88% in sustainable request rate compared to previous solutions.
